I used this idea for oven-roasted potatoes with delicata squash. I had some bacon grease so to mimic the grease from the sausages on the potatoes I used bacon grease with the olive oil. I tossed them with powdered rosemary, onion powder, garlic powder, salt, pepper, and a bit of red pepper flakes. Sprayed the pan, spread them out to a single layer, and cooked them at 475°.
